Description:
JOB DESCRIPTION/REQUIREMENTS
Responsibilities
- Build, engage, and manage the community of installers and clients
- Create a feedback system for enquiries, complaints and suggestions as regards service delivery
- Support solar project development and acquisition
- Support new market research and development opportunities, including emerging solar markets, energy storage, low-income community solar, and wholesale markets
- Create online and offline channels for brand awareness and engagement of the organization’s solar products and services
- Coordinate and track solar projects under development or acquisition phase through closing
- Scout for newbie and skilled solar installers across the country
- Organize installers’ capacity development programs
- Drive growth and promotion of the organization’s service offerings through its coordination of its network of professional installers and technicians
- Create massive awareness campaign programs among the public about the huge benefits of the organization’s solar products
- Keep and grow the organization’s communities of solar installers and clients engaged across official social media channels and in-person events
- Track and coordinate installation schedules among installers
Facilitate official communication and correspondence between the organization and field-installers (freelancers and full-time technicians)Other assigned community-related tasks
Requirements
- Ideally, 3 years’ experience in the solar industry with focus in any of project management, process administration, deal execution, stakeholder engagement, account management and people coordination, etc.
- Strong internal and external communication skills and an ability to manage multiple issues and clearly articulate outcomes, concerns and solutions
- Bachelor’s degree in Public Relations, Marketing, Business Administration, or a related field
- Leadership dexterity
- Adept at the use of various social media platforms
- Understanding of solar fundamentals, and familiarity with the Nigerian solar community preferred
- Exceptional organization and communication skills
- Entrepreneurial/driven and persistent work ethic
Commitment to best-in-class customer service to both internal and external customersDemonstrated interest in building a stronger, cleaner economy and deploying more solar
